Abstract(in English) | The coming mobile communication systems such as 5G, ultra-high-speed data transmission is expected anywhere in a cell. In a mobile communication system in which the same frequency uses in all cells, communication quality deteriorates due to inter-cell interference especially in the cell edge. As an interference cancel technique for downlink, the authors proposed an interference cancel technique that applies adaptive beamforming using Massive MIMO antennas to a virtualized cell MU-MIMO canceller, which cancels adjacent cell interference by configuring a virtual cell in cooperation with neighboring base stations and showed that the communication quality can be significantly improved by applying the canceller. In the same way, interference cancel techniques in the uplink are expected. In this paper, we propose an uplink interference cancel technique that applies the proposed technique to the uplink and clarify the effectiveness of its application. |
